Warning Signs You Need Antimicrobial Treatment Services
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ly damage and serious health issues. Don’t wait until it’s too late. Be aware of the following signs and take prompt action: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A persistent, unpleasant smell in your home can be a sign of a larger issue. If you’ve tried to remove the odor with cleaning products or air fresheners, but it persists, it’s likely a sign of mold growth. Don’t ignore this warning sign, take action to prevent further damage.
Visible Signs of Water Damage
Water spots, warping, or discoloration on walls, ceilings, or floors are clear indicators of water damage. If you’ve experienced a leak or flooding,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ent mold growth and structural damage.
Unexplained Allergies or Respiratory Issues
If you or a family member is experiencing unexplained allergies or respiratory issues, it could be a sign of indoor air pollution. Mold and bacteria growth can release spores and toxins that exacerbate respiratory problems. Take action to identify and address the source of the issue.
Unpleasant Taste or Smell in Drinking Water
A foul taste or smell in your drinking water can show the presence of bacteria or other contaminants. Don’t risk your family’s health, take action to identify and address the issue.
Visible Pests or Rodents
Seeing pests or rodents in your home can be a sign of a larger issue. These critters can carry diseases and contaminate food and surfaces. Take action to identify and address the source of the infestation.
Unexplained Stains or Discoloration
Unexplained stains or discoloration on wal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of water dam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ore this warning sign, take action to identify and address the issue.
Antimicrobial Treatment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Visible signs of mold growth in a small area | Yes | No | You can use a DIY mold treatment kit and follow the instructions carefully. |
| Large-scale water damage affecting multiple rooms | No | Yes | A professional team will have the equipment and expertise to handle the situation efficiently and effectively. |
| Unexplained allergies or respiratory issues | No | Yes | A professional can help identify the source of the issue and provide a customized solution. |
| Visible pests or rodents in the home | No | Yes | A professional team will have the equipment and expertise to safely and effectively remove the infestation. |
| Unpleasant taste or smell in drinking water | No | Yes | A professional can help identify the source of the issue and provide a customized solution to ensure safe drinking water. |
| Visible stains or discoloration on walls or ceilings | Maybe | Yes | It’s better to err on the side of caution and consult a professional to find out the cause and develop a plan to address the issue. |
